The history of motorcycles dates back to the mid-19th century when inventors started experimenting with steam-powered and gasoline-powered engines. However, it wasn't until the late 1800s that the first practical motorcycle was invented. In 1885, Gottlieb Daimler and Wilhelm Maybach created the "Reitwagen," considered the world's first gasoline-powered motorcycle. The Reitwagen had a single-cylinder engine and could reach speeds of up to 12 miles per hour. Over the next few decades, motorcycle technology continued to evolve, with companies like Harley-Davidson, Indian, and Triumph emerging as major players in the industry. In the early 20th century, motorcycles were widely used in World War I for reconnaissance and communication purposes. In the post-war era, motorcycles became more popular for recreational purposes.
